The primary goal of treatment for adjustment disorder is to relieve symptoms and to help an individual achieve a level of functioning comparable to what they demonstrated prior to the stressful event. Some people, however, react to stressors much more intensely (e.g., with greater anxiety and depression) or experience more functional impairment (e.g., greater difficulties at work or school) than do others. Most people recover from adjustment disorder without any remaining symptoms if they have no previous history of mental illness and have access to stable social support. Stressors may be recurrent events, such as a child repeatedly witnessing his or her parents fighting, or continuous, such as living in a crime-ridden neighborhood. According to the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ders (DSM5), approximately 5-20% of persons seen in outpatient mental health clinics receive a diagnosis of an adjustment disorder. Adjustment disorder with disturbance of conduct: Symptoms are demonstrated in behaviors that break societal norms or violate the rights of others. Objectives goals are the larger, more broad outcomes the therapist and client are working for, while multiple objectives make up each goal; they are small, achievable steps that make up a goal.
